After being declared worthy in character and learning, he was awarded with a certificate on Friday.
The convict earned a Post Graduate Diploma in Education.
In response, Onwuzulike expressed his gratitude to the Custodial Centre and NOUN for the chance, according to NOUN UPDATE News.
When I first arrived here, I had no idea such a thing existed. I believed such things were only found in developed nations. I started here with just one credential, but now I have three, and I'm ready to get another before I go.
I want my fellow detainees to view this as a stepping stone. It's time to enroll; you may do so even if you've been released. 'You'll never be sorry,' he said.
During the certificate giving, Dr Scholastica Ezeribe, Director of NOUN, Awka Study Centre, expressed her joy at the inmates' zeal for academics.
Ezeribe, represented by Dr Georgina Ogbonna, urged other detainees to take advantage of the government's free chance to improve their lot before their release.
